Role in Cancer Patient Care

Cancer patients often need input beyond oncology alone. Dr. Patil supports the cancer team in the following ways:

  • Pre-anaesthesia evaluation before major cancer surgery, checking heart, lung, and general health fitness for surgery
  • Anaesthesia delivery during oncology procedures, tailored to the patient’s overall health and prior treatments
  • Orthopaedic review for patients with bone-related symptoms, mobility problems, or musculoskeletal side effects of cancer treatment
  • Post-operative pain management to support faster recovery and comfort during onward cancer treatment

All decisions about cancer diagnosis and treatment (surgery, chemotherapy, radiation, or immunotherapy) are made by the treating oncology team. Dr. Patil’s role is supportive and procedural.

Why Would A Cancer Patient Consult An Orthopaedic And Anaesthesia Specialist?

Cancer patients may need anaesthesia for surgery, pain relief for bone symptoms, or orthopaedic review for mobility issues during or after treatment.
